Boxwood trimming services involve carefully shaping and maintaining the health of boxwood hedges and shrubs. This process typically includes removing overgrown branches, shaping the plants to desired forms, and ensuring that the foliage remains dense and attractive. Proper trimming not only enhances the visual appeal of a property but also encourages healthy growth by preventing the plants from becoming too leggy or uneven. Skilled contractors use the right tools and techniques to achieve a clean, natural look while promoting the longevity of the boxwoods.

These services can help address common problems such as overgrown or unruly foliage, which can obscure views, block walkways, or diminish curb appeal. Overgrown boxwoods are also more susceptible to disease and pest issues, as dense, untrimmed foliage can trap moisture and hinder air circulation. Regular trimming helps maintain the plants’ health and appearance, reducing the risk of infestations or decay. Additionally, trimming can prevent branches from rubbing against structures or neighboring plants, which can cause damage or create an unkempt look.

The overview below groups typical Boxwood Trimming proj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Lynchburg, VA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Small Trimming Jobs - Typical costs for routine boxwood trimming in Lynchburg range from $250 to $600 for many smaller or maintenance-focused projects. Many homeowners schedule these services annually or semi-annually to maintain their landscape aesthetic. Fewer projects tend to push beyond this range unless additional landscaping work is included.

Medium-Scale Trimming - For larger shrub beds or more intricate shaping, local contractors often charge between $600 and $1,200. Projects in this range are common for homeowners seeking a more detailed or extensive trimming. Larger or more complex jobs can occasionally reach $1,500 or more.

Large or Complex Projects - Extensive trimming involving multiple beds, hard-to-reach areas, or detailed shaping can cost from $1,200 to $3,000. These projects are less frequent but are suitable for properties with significant landscaping needs or for seasonal overhauls.

Full Replacement or Major Overhaul - Replacing or completely redoing boxwood hedges can start at $3,000 and may exceed $5,000 depending on the size and scope. Such projects are less common and typically involve significant planning and coordination with local service providers.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is involved in boxwood trimming services? Boxwood trimming services typically include shaping, pruning, and maintaining the health of boxwood shrubs to enhance their appearance and promote growth.

Why should I consider professional boxwood trimming? Hiring local contractors ensures that your boxwoods are properly pruned to prevent damage, improve aesthetics, and support the plant's overall health.

How often should boxwoods be trimmed? The frequency of trimming depends on the growth rate and desired shape, but many homeowners opt for seasonal or annual maintenance by experienced service providers.

What tools are used during boxwood trimming? Professionals often use sharp pruning shears, hedge trimmers, and hand tools to carefully shape and prune boxwoods without harming the plants.

Can trimming help prevent common boxwood problems? Yes, proper trimming can reduce issues like overgrowth, disease, and pest infestations by promoting healthy growth and removing damaged or diseased branches.
